I'm of the opinion that you can be flexible on the powers/abilities of a vampire in order to fit the vampire into the narrative you're creating. If an element of the myth doesn't work for your storyline, chuck it. Bottom line is to come up with a good story that you like. I think the big ones to work with are blood drinking and nocturnal activity, but there's a lot of explanations for those behaviors that can be used. I've been in a couple different vampire-themed RP's, but the one I am currently doing requires me to decide just what is and isn't the case with the abilities of vampires, and so this is an interesting discussion to keep an eye on.